Cabinet Reshuffles in Nuevo León State

Rumors of new cabinet adjustments are circulating in Nuevo León. The governor may take a leave of absence after the World Cup, becoming part of negotiations with the opposition. Martha Herrera is set to change positions, with Daniel Acosta poised to take her place.

Aldo Faci has received the green light from Miguel Flores. In fact, for several weeks now, Faci has been persistently questioning Mayor Adrián De la Garza, almost as a central figure in the plans of Flores and Faci for the state capital. A replacement for Faci in the Citizen Participation department has not yet appeared on the horizon, although it would not be an urgent matter, unlike another rumor that has been circulating since Monday. This rumor suggests that after the World Cup, the governor will take a leave of absence to begin tours across the country in preparation for his 2027 campaign. If confirmed, this would be another element in the legislative negotiation with the opposition, a dialogue that already goes beyond the budget and touches on issues such as the confirmation of the new treasurer or a possible leave of absence. According to sources at the Palace of Cantera, Secretary Martha Herrera would move from the Secretariat of Equality to the head of the AMAR Office, where Mariana Rodríguez serves in an honorary capacity. This move would align with the idea of bolstering Rodríguez and Herrera, who are key electoral swords for the 2027 elections—the former to contend for the governorship and the latter for the mayoralty of Monterrey. Herrera's position would be taken by Daniel Acosta, the current head of Citizen Participation, who is seeking to accelerate an electoral project also anchored in Monterrey. This is a Plan B in case Herrera's options do not take off. The year begins with rumors of new adjustments in the state cabinet.
